Fruitport committee reviews resolution to levy summer property taxes in two townships

Fruitport Community Schools Business and Finance Committee · October 13, 2025

The Business and Finance Committee heard a presentation of a resolution that would allow Fruitport Community Schools to levy summer property taxes in Spring Lake and Fruitport townships in summer 2026; no committee vote was recorded.

Mark Mesbergen presented a resolution on Oct. 13 authorizing Fruitport Community Schools to levy summer property taxes in Spring Lake and Fruitport townships during summer 2026.

The committee minutes record the presentation but show no motion, vote, or formal action on the resolution at that meeting. Mesbergen indicated the resolution would move through the usual board process; the minutes do not state a timeline for a vote.

No public comment was recorded on the resolution during the committee meeting, and the minutes list no amendments or fiscal specifics tied to the resolution in the committee discussion.
